A Geological Story Millions of Years in the Making
Long before modern drilling rigs existed, vast prehistoric oceans covered large portions of what is now Texas and other energy-producing regions. Over millions of years, organic material accumulated beneath layers of sediment and rock.
As pressure and heat increased deep underground, those materials gradually transformed into oil and natural gas deposits. These geological formations eventually became some of the most valuable energy resources on the planet.
Today, drilling companies invest enormous resources locating and extracting these reserves. Entire regional economies have been built around energy production made possible by geological events that occurred long before human civilization existed.
Pressure Must Be Controlled at All Times
One of the biggest challenges facing drilling crews involves managing underground pressure safely. Oil and gas reservoirs can contain tremendous amounts of energy that must be controlled carefully throughout drilling operations.
Specialized equipment is used to monitor and regulate pressure conditions inside the well. Crews rely on detailed procedures designed to prevent dangerous situations from developing unexpectedly.
When pressure control systems fail or procedures are not followed properly, the results can be catastrophic. Blowouts, fires, and explosions remain among the most serious hazards in the energy industry, which is why pressure management receives so much attention on drilling sites.
Fatigue Creates Risks That Are Easy to Miss
Oilfield operations often run around the clock. Workers may spend long hours performing physically demanding tasks in harsh weather conditions while operating heavy equipment.
Fatigue can affect concentration, communication, and reaction times. A simple oversight that might be harmless in an office environment can have much more serious consequences around drilling machinery or industrial equipment.
Many companies have implemented fatigue management programs to address these concerns. Even so, worker exhaustion continues to be a factor in some workplace incidents, particularly during extended shifts and overnight operations.
Responsibility Can Be Difficult to Untangle
Modern drilling sites often involve multiple companies working together simultaneously. Contractors, subcontractors, equipment providers, and site operators may all perform different functions at the same location.
When an accident occurs, determining responsibility is not always straightforward. Various parties may attempt to shift blame while investigators work to determine who controlled specific operations and whether safety obligations were met.
Because of these overlapping relationships, oilfield accident investigations can become highly complex. Examining contracts, training records, maintenance documentation, and operational procedures often becomes necessary to understand exactly what happened.
